Current Goal

"Old West" wants to travel the New West to see the changes.

About This Item

The Lid Opener came to New Mexico in 1914 with my Grandparents, when the family came from Chicago. We picked up the copper buckle in Spirit cache by Joel and Lynne Mozer in Alamogordo. The lid and band was picked up on the NM high desert. UP & DP the Unacorns
